Output 712635ca8530ecbdfd30e25ff8be16bfa1fa7a2e14c8bd80e18a5f1ec7f1a736:0

value
998394
script pubkey
OP_0 OP_PUSHBYTES_20 68891b61be91964dcd33100d440f3cae243398d1
address
bc1qdzy3kcd7jxtymnfnzqx5greu4cjr8xx3f6gj3x
transaction
712635ca8530ecbdfd30e25ff8be16bfa1fa7a2e14c8bd80e18a5f1ec7f1a736
confirmations
34209
spent
true